PostgreSQL protiv MySQL: razlika i usporedba

PostgreSQL i MySQL su sustavi za upravljanje bazama podataka. Ima različite zahtjeve. Upotreba ovisi o programeru koji koristi sustav za upravljanje bazom podataka.

Važna je aplikacija za koju će se baza podataka koristiti na odgovarajući način. Oba su dva sustava za upravljanje bazama podataka otvorenog koda. Sustav ne može raditi na svim operativnim sustavima.

Ključni za poneti

  1. PostgreSQL i MySQL popularni su sustavi za upravljanje relacijskim bazama podataka otvorenog koda.
  2. PostgreSQL ima naprednije značajke i prikladniji je za složene aplikacije, dok je MySQL lakši za korištenje i prikladniji za male i srednje aplikacije.
  3. PostgreSQL se koristi u financijama, zdravstvu i državnoj industriji, dok se MySQL obično koristi za web aplikacije.

PostgreSQL protiv MySQL

Razlika između PostgreSQL-a i MySQL-a je što PostgreSQL koristi objektno-relacijski sustav upravljanja bazom podataka, ali MySQL koristi relacijski sustav upravljanja bazom podataka. MySQL je razvio Oracle, ali je Global Development Group napravio PostgreSQL. MySQL se može učiniti proširivim, ali PostgreSQL ne može biti proširiv. PostgreSQL nema osobni backup, ali MySQL ima svoj vlastiti backup sustav koji se zove Mysql đubrište.

PostgreSQL protiv MySQL

PostgreSQL je sustav za upravljanje bazom podataka. Koristi objektno-relacijsko upravljanje bazom podataka. Napravila ga je Global Development Group. Može se pokrenuti u sustavima Windows i Mac OS X, ali ne može se pokrenuti u sustavima Symbian, AmigaOS i UNIX. Vrlo je rastezljiv. Pruža materijalizirani pogled i privremenu tablicu u svom sustavu.

MySQL je sustav za upravljanje bazom podataka. Koristi relacijsku bazu podataka. Korporacija Oracle napravila je proizvod MySQL. Nije proširiv. Može se koristiti u sustavima Windows, Mac OS X, UNIX i mnogim drugim platformama.

Ima sigurnosne usluge Mysqldump i XtraBackup. Nema objekt domene podataka. Ima privremenu tablicu, ali nema materijalizirani pogled.

Tabela za usporedbu

Parametri usporedbePostgreSQLMySQL
Vrsta baze podatakaObjektno relacijskiRelacijski
razvijačGrupa za globalni razvojProročanstvo
PlatformeWindows, MacOS XUNIX, Symbian, Windows, Mac OS X
ExtensibleNeDa
rezervaNa linijiMySQL ispis
Objekt podatkovne domeneDaNe

Što je PostgreSQL?

PostgreSQL je sustav otvorenog koda. To je upravljanje relacijskom bazom podataka. Dodaje velike prednosti usklađenosti sa SQL-om. Izvorni naziv sustava bio je POSTGRES. To je nadogradnja Ingres baze podataka.

Također pročitajte:  Gruba sila protiv napada rječnikom: razlika i usporedba

Sustav je osmislilo i razvilo Kalifornijsko sveučilište Berkeley. To je upravljanje relacijskim skupom podataka tipa objekta.

Ima nekoliko prednosti koje sustav čine produktivnijim. Značajke su izolacija, atomičnost i dosljednost u transakcijama u sustavu. Ima materijalističke poglede.

Ima okidače, strane ključeve i svojstva trajnosti. Napravljen je tako da može podnijeti radna opterećenja na jednom stroju. Može staviti podatke u skladišta podataka.

Dodaje sve stvari ili podatke web uslugama. Ima mnogo istovremenih korisnika. Ovo je baza podataka koju koristi MacOS poslužitelj. Ovo je zadani sustav. Ovu bazu podataka također mogu koristiti Windows, FreeBSD, OpenBSD i Linux. Sustav je proširiv za upravljanje bazom podataka.

Ingres je bio prvi sustav koji je razvijen, ali je zatim nadograđen na PostgreSQL i uspješno se razvijao. Dodao je nove značajke i podržane su sve vrste podataka. Sustav razumije odnos i dohvaća informacije na bolji način.

PostgreSQL

Što je MySQL?

To je sustav za upravljanje bazom podataka. To je platforma otvorenog koda. Ova baza podataka organizira podatke u mnoge tablice. Sustav razumije odnose između različitih tipova podataka. Može pravilno modificirati podatke.

Ovo je jezični programer. Stavlja informacije u tablice, što se može lako učiniti.

Implementira relacijsku bazu podataka. Omogućuje pristup mreži i testira integritet sigurnosnih kopija. To je softver otvorenog koda kojeg održava Opća javna licenca. Korporacija Oracle je u posljednje vrijeme razvila MySQL.

Mnogi ga smatraju otvorenim kodom licence. Bio je u vlasništvu i sponzoru MySQL-a.

Ima samostalne klijente. Omogućuje korisnicima trenutnu interakciju s bazom podataka, zbog čega se korisnik može vrlo dobro brinuti o bazi podataka. Može se koristiti s drugim programima. Potreban je sustav relacijske baze podataka. MySQL nema proširiv sustav. Razvio ga je Oracle.

Također pročitajte:  Maksimalna širina u odnosu na minimalnu širinu: razlika i usporedba

Ovu platformu koriste mnoge poznate i popularne platforme za svoje web stranice. Web stranice su Flickr, Facebook, i Twitter. Ova platforma je prethodno bila u vlasništvu MySQL AB, ali je onda platforma prešla pod Sun Microsystems. Ova tvrtka je sada poznata kao Oracle.

tekst

Glavne razlike između PostgreSQL-a i MySQL-a

  1. PostgreSQL koristi objektno-relacijsku bazu podataka, dok MySQL koristi relacijsku bazu podataka.
  2. Global Development Group razvila je PostgreSQL, a Oracle MySQL.
  3. PostgreSQL se može pokrenuti na Windowsima, Mac OS X i mnogim drugima, ali MySQL se može pokrenuti na UNIX, Symbian, Windows i Mac OS X.
  4. PostgreSQL ima proširiv sustav upravljanja bazom podataka, dok MySQL nema proširiv sustav.
  5. PostgreSQL se može sigurnosno kopirati online backupom, dok se MySQL može sigurnosno kopirati putem MySQLdumpa.
  6. Data Domain Object nudi PostgreSQL, ali ne i MySQL.
Razlika između PostgreSQL i MySQL
Reference
  1. https://momjian.us/main/writings/pgsql/other/bookfigs.pdf
  2. https://books.google.com/books?hl=en&lr=&id=cCiA8HsQhGUC&oi=fnd&pg=PT36&dq=mysql&ots=TvY3YS5Y-d&sig=RMOBn3q4lKc_sHO83IBas9EbGiI

Zadnje ažuriranje: 23. srpnja 2023

točka 1
Jedan zahtjev?

Uložio sam mnogo truda u pisanje ovog posta na blogu kako bih vam pružio vrijednost. Bit će mi od velike pomoći ako razmislite o tome da to podijelite na društvenim medijima ili sa svojim prijateljima/obitelji. DIJELJENJE JE ♥️

24 mišljenja o “PostgreSQL protiv MySQL: razlika i usporedba”

  1. Usporedna tablica pruža jasnu raščlambu razlikovnih značajki i funkcionalnosti PostgreSQL-a i MySQL-a, olakšavajući čitateljima da shvate razlike između ovih sustava upravljanja bazom podataka.

    odgovor
  2. Detaljni opisi PostgreSQL-a i MySQL-a nude vrijedan uvid u njihovo podrijetlo, funkcionalnosti i slučajeve korištenja. Ovaj je sadržaj koristan za pojedince koji traže dubinsko znanje o tim sustavima za upravljanje bazama podataka.

    odgovor
    • Apsolutno, članak zadire u temeljne aspekte PostgreSQL-a i MySQL-a, omogućujući čitateljima da razumiju zamršene detalje ovih sustava i njihove primjene u raznim industrijama.

      odgovor
  3. Informativni zapis učinkovito ilustrira ključne razlike u strukturama baza podataka i funkcionalnostima između PostgreSQL-a i MySQL-a, poboljšavajući čitateljevo razumijevanje ova dva sustava.

    odgovor
    • Doista, detaljna usporedba i jasna objašnjenja služe kao izvrstan izvor za pojedince koji traže sveobuhvatno razumijevanje mogućnosti i prikladnosti PostgreSQL-a i MySQL-a za različite vrste aplikacija.

      odgovor
    • Detaljna analiza PostgreSQL-a i MySQL-a unapređuje znanje čitatelja i pruža dragocjene uvide u bitne aspekte ovih sustava za upravljanje bazama podataka, pomažući u donošenju boljih odluka za razvoj aplikacija.

      odgovor
  4. Sveobuhvatne informacije predstavljene u članku učinkovito naglašavaju ključne razlike i karakteristične značajke PostgreSQL-a i MySQL-a, zadovoljavajući intelektualne potrebe čitatelja koji traže dubinsko znanje o tim sustavima upravljanja bazama podataka.

    odgovor
    • Apsolutno, sadržaj članka intelektualno obogaćuje, baca svjetlo na nijansirane razlike i prikladnost PostgreSQL-a i MySQL-a, čime pomaže čitateljima u donošenju informiranih izbora za njihove potrebe upravljanja bazom podataka.

      odgovor
    • Točnije, detaljna usporedba članka poboljšava razumijevanje čitatelja o bitnim aspektima PostgreSQL-a i MySQL-a, pružajući vrijedne uvide profesionalcima koji se bave upravljanjem bazama podataka i razvojem aplikacija.

      odgovor
  5. Pronicljiva usporedba između PostgreSQL-a i MySQL-a služi kao neprocjenjiv izvor znanja za programere i stručnjake za baze podataka, nudeći sveobuhvatan uvid u temeljne značajke i primjenjivost ovih sustava za upravljanje bazama podataka.

    odgovor
  6. Detaljna objašnjenja članka i komparativna analiza PostgreSQL-a i MySQL-a doprinose temeljitom razumijevanju njihovih značajki, čineći ga vrijednim izvorom za programere i administratore baza podataka.

    odgovor
    • Doista, članak pruža detaljne detalje o funkcionalnostima i karakteristikama PostgreSQL-a i MySQL-a, omogućujući čitateljima da steknu dublje razumijevanje ovih sustava za upravljanje bazama podataka i njihovu primjenjivost u različitim scenarijima.

      odgovor
    • Informativni sadržaj nudi izvrsnu usporedbu između PostgreSQL-a i MySQL-a, osnažujući čitatelje da razaznaju jedinstvene prednosti i slučajeve korištenja ovih sustava baza podataka, čime pomaže u donošenju informiranih odluka.

      odgovor
  7. Detaljni opisi i analize PostgreSQL-a i MySQL-a značajno pridonose čitateljevom razumijevanju ovih sustava baza podataka, pružajući sveobuhvatan izvor za pojedince koji žele unaprijediti svoje znanje u ovoj domeni.

    odgovor
    • Apsolutno, članak obogaćuje perspektive čitatelja o PostgreSQL-u i MySQL-u, pružajući detaljan okvir za razumijevanje njihovih funkcionalnosti i procjenu njihove prikladnosti za različite aplikacije.

      odgovor
    • Sadržaj nudi informativne uvide u ključne razlike između PostgreSQL-a i MySQL-a, omogućujući čitateljima da razumiju jedinstvene značajke i donesu informirane odluke o usvajanju ovih sustava baza podataka.

      odgovor
  8. Sveobuhvatna pokrivenost članka PostgreSQL-om i MySQL-om pruža čitateljima nijansirano razumijevanje njihovih kontrastnih atributa i praktičnih implementacija, služeći kao izniman obrazovni resurs za entuzijaste i profesionalce baza podataka.

    odgovor
    • Točnije, sadržaj članka intelektualno obogaćuje, baca svjetlo na nijansirane razlike i prikladnost PostgreSQL-a i MySQL-a, čime čitateljima pomaže u donošenju informiranih izbora za njihove potrebe upravljanja bazom podataka.

      odgovor
  9. Članak pruža sveobuhvatnu usporedbu između PostgreSQL-a i MySQL-a, jasno ocrtavajući specifične prednosti i slučajeve upotrebe za svaki od ovih sustava za upravljanje bazom podataka. Korisno je razumjeti ključne razlike između njih i bitno za programere da odaberu pravi sustav na temelju svojih projektnih zahtjeva.

    odgovor
    • Članak učinkovito naglašava razlike u značajkama, slučajevima korištenja i razvojnim aspektima PostgreSQL-a i MySQL-a. To je odlična referenca za one koji žele dublje razumjeti ova dva popularna sustava za upravljanje bazom podataka.

      odgovor
    • Slažem se, ovdje navedene informacije izuzetno su vrijedne za programere i sve koji rade sa sustavima za upravljanje bazama podataka. Ključno je imati temeljito razumijevanje PostgreSQL-a i MySQL-a za donošenje informiranih odluka.

      odgovor
  10. Sveobuhvatan pregled PostgreSQL-a i MySQL-a u članku daje čitateljima jasnu sliku temeljnih razlika i tehničkih aspekata ovih sustava za upravljanje bazama podataka, nudeći osnovno znanje za programere i donositelje odluka.

    odgovor
    • Apsolutno, članak služi kao obrazovni vodič za one koji su zainteresirani za razumijevanje funkcionalnosti i slučajeva korištenja PostgreSQL-a i MySQL-a, pružajući dragocjene uvide za informirano donošenje odluka pri odabiru baze podataka.

      odgovor
    • Detaljna usporedba između PostgreSQL-a i MySQL-a vrlo je informativna i razjašnjava razlikovne značajke ovih sustava za upravljanje bazom podataka, omogućujući čitateljima da shvate njihovu korisnost i optimiziraju njihovu prikladnu upotrebu.

      odgovor

Ostavite komentar

Želite li spremiti ovaj članak za kasnije? Kliknite srce u donjem desnom kutu da biste ga spremili u svoj okvir za članke!